I like Pat Hill as a candidate. He's a great coach who turned 2-star recruits at Fresno State into BCS contenders. His old motto at Fresno State was "Anytime, anywhere." Remember all those upsets of top 25 teams he orchestrated there? He is very much available at the moment. Currently he's the O-line coach for the Atlanta Falcons. If Jim Mora somehow declines to become the Huskies coach by electing to stay put at UCLA, then I would immediately give Pat Hill the job. He's a players coach. While Pat Hill would not be the sexiest hire, he'd be a good hire with a proven winning track-record none to less. He'll bring stability to our program by putting together a good staff behind him, he'll hold most our recruiting class together, he'll win the hearts and minds of our players, and he'll move our program forward. The only concern I have with Hill is his age—61. In 2008 after Steve Woodward fired Ty Willingham, Pat Hill was in the running right behind Sark. Peace.
